Evaluate Your Treatment Options
Understanding the various treatment choices is crucial. Common methods include corticosteroid injections to soften the scar, silicone gel sheets for flattening, laser therapy to reduce redness and size, and surgical eyelid surgery malaysia removal for more severe cases. Each option should be weighed according to the scar’s characteristics and your skin type to maximize effectiveness and minimize recurrence.
